@import url('https://fonts.googleapis.com/css2?family=DynaPuff:wght@400;600&display=swap');

:root {
    --color-bg: #0A1628;
    --color-surface: #0F1F3D;
    --color-primary: #157AFE;
    --color-primary-dark: #1E3A8A;
    --color-primary-light: #3B82F6;
    --color-text: #F1F5F9;
    --color-text-muted: #94A3B8;
    --color-border: #1E3A8A;
    --color-error: #F87171;
    --color-success: #4ADE80;

    --font-brand: 'DynaPuff', system-ui, sans-serif;
    --font-base: system-ui, -apple-system, sans-serif;

    --radius-sm: 8px;
    --radius-md: 14px;
    --radius-lg: 20px;

    --space-xs: 0.5rem;
    --space-sm: 1rem;
    --space-md: 1.5rem;
    --space-lg: 2.5rem;
    --space-xl: 4rem;

    --max-content: 680px;
}

*,
*::before,
*::after {
    box-sizing: border-box;
    margin: 0;
    padding: 0;
}

html {
    font-size: 16px;
    -webkit-text-size-adjust: 100%;
}

body {
    background-color: var(--color-bg);
    color: var(--color-text);
    font-family: var(--font-base);
    line-height: 1.6;
    min-height: 100dvh;
}

a {
    color: var(--color-primary-light);
    text-decoration: none;
}

a:hover {
    color: var(--color-primary);
}

img {
    display: block;
    max-width: 100%;
}